Cytovia’s got Talen: Cellectis NK cell gene editing pact worth up to $775M

Feb. 16, 2021
By Cormac Sheridan
DUBLIN – Cellectis SA is picking up $15 million worth of equity in Cytovia Therapeutics Inc. and could earn as much as $760 million in development, regulatory and sales milestones from a deal involving up to five gene-edited allogeneic natural killer (NK) cell or chimeric antigen receptor (CAR-NK) cell therapies employing its Talen (transcription activator-like effector nuclease) gene editing technology.

Verve brings in a $94M series B for gene editing R&D

Jan. 19, 2021
By Lee Landenberger
Sekar Kathiresan is building Verve Therapeutics Inc. around the concept of a one-and-done treatment for cardiovascular disease because only half of patients are disciplined enough to take a statin every day. “That’s a huge issue for durable cholesterol lowering after a heart attack,” Verve’s CEO and co-founder told BioWorld.

Metagenomi launches with $65M series A and long leash in gene editing

Nov. 12, 2020
By Lee Landenberger
Metagenomi Inc. has raised a $65 million series A financing to expand its gene editing abilities, advance its research and validate its pipeline in preclinical studies. The company’s CRISPR-based systems use algorithms for screening thousands of genomes from microorganisms to advance therapies for use in oncology, genetic diseases and possibly much more.

Making neurons from glia alleviates neurodegenerative diseases

April 17, 2020
By John Fox
Chinese scientists have shown for the first time that the down-regulation of a single RNA-binding protein, polypyrimidine tract-binding protein 1 (Ptbp1), locally converted glial cells to neurons and showed promise for treating the symptoms of neurodegenerative diseases in mice.

Editas, Allergan see first patient dosed with CRISPR candidate for LCA10

March 4, 2020
By Michael Fitzhugh
An experimental gene editing therapy for an inherited form of blindness has become the first in vivo CRISPR medicine to be administered to patients, according to Editas Medicine Inc. and its partner, Allergan plc, which licensed the candidate in 2018.
